| 释义 | > as lemmascheat sheet   cheat sheet  n. slang (chiefly U.S.) a piece of paper bearing notes or instructions as an aid to memory, esp. when used surreptitiously by a student in an examination, etc.; a crib; also in extended use. ΚΠ 1935    G. Barker Janus i. 29  				Which, sewn upon the cheat-sheet of life, divert from cosmic legerdemain our obvious knowledge: that this face too must die. 1960    M. A. Felder Collegiate Slang 1  				Cheat sheet, any written material used to cheat in a test. 1978    Eng. Jrnl. Dec. 58/2  				Using a fake ID to buy wine or beer. Taking a cheat sheet into a test. 2000    Herald 		(Glasgow)	 		(Electronic ed.)	 12 May  				During a recent Labour Party night out..songsheets had to be provided for old Lefty classics such as Bandiera Rossa. Curiously, when this song is sung at SNP soirees no-one needs a cheat sheet. < as lemmas  |
